March 2025, though still in the future, can be expected to exhibit typical early spring conditions in Greece. This period signifies a transition from the mild, wetter winter to the warmer, drier summer. Daily temperatures generally range from cool to mild, ideal for outdoor activities without the intense heat of the summer months. Coastal regions will likely experience milder temperatures than inland areas, while mountainous regions might still see some snowfall, particularly at higher elevations.
